Output 8325161c5f58da2a0102f05d702efa9b32da84100a8419eec3be3f591c03afdf:0

value
12977830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6540ce7504ee1e9052b164fe81f76cd65e8c659 OP_EQUAL
address
3KmgQT6JC2But7g7eeHnZWMDFFUApXEtrU
transaction
8325161c5f58da2a0102f05d702efa9b32da84100a8419eec3be3f591c03afdf
spent
true